School Psychology Quarterly is a peer-reviewed academic journal published by the American Psychological Association on behalf of Division 16. The journal was established in 1986 and covers topics such as the "psychology of education and services for children in school settings." [1] The current editor-in-chief is Richard C. Gilman of Cincinnati Children's Hospital Medical Center.

Abstracting and indexing

The journal is abstracted and indexed by MEDLINE/PubMed and the Social Science Citation Index. According to the Journal Citation Reports, the journal has a 2016 impact factor of 3.256, ranking it 6th out of 58 journals in the category "Psychology, Educational".[2]
